首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何定义泛型参数Class[]并在restTemplateBuilder.getForObject()上使用它?

泛型参数Class[]是一个用于定义泛型类型的数组。在Java中,泛型参数Class表示一个类的类型,而Class[]表示多个类的类型。

在使用restTemplateBuilder.getForObject()方法时,可以通过泛型参数Class[]来指定返回结果的类型。具体步骤如下:

  1. 首先,创建一个Class[]数组,用于存储泛型参数的类型。例如,如果要返回一个List<User>类型的结果,可以使用以下代码创建Class[]数组:
  2. 首先,创建一个Class[]数组,用于存储泛型参数的类型。例如,如果要返回一个List<User>类型的结果,可以使用以下代码创建Class[]数组:
  3. 这里使用了通配符?来表示List中的具体类型。
  4. 然后,将泛型参数Class[]数组作为参数传递给restTemplateBuilder.getForObject()方法。例如:
  5. 然后,将泛型参数Class[]数组作为参数传递给restTemplateBuilder.getForObject()方法。例如:
  6. 这样,restTemplateBuilder将会根据泛型参数Class[]数组中的类型来解析返回结果,并将结果转换为指定的类型。

泛型参数Class[]的使用可以使得在不同的场景下,动态地指定返回结果的类型,提高代码的灵活性和复用性。

腾讯云相关产品和产品介绍链接地址: 暂无相关产品和链接地址。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券